Output efe66a21a3ca49c18511d99bc2d68f3f57108d9e0fb205d1701a1205aaabb100:1

value
179835000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 883298e26b4cbdc1fa0ebee4e95c4b9a38da5b78 OP_EQUALVERIFY OP_CHECKSIG
address
DHZF3uKHU582AJqUWLsTNsYKNZAjGERdXc
transaction
efe66a21a3ca49c18511d99bc2d68f3f57108d9e0fb205d1701a1205aaabb100